CVE: CVE-2011-1020
CVE: CVE-2011-1020
Id:
CVE-2011-1020
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2011-1020
Comment
: The proc filesystem implementation in the Linux kernel 2.6.37 and earlier does not restrict access to the /proc directory tree of a process after this process performs an exec of a setuid program, which allows local users to obtain sensitive information or cause a denial of service via open, lseek, read, and write system calls.

CVE: CVE-2011-3347
CVE: CVE-2011-3347
Id:
CVE-2011-3347
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2011-3347
Comment
: A certain Red Hat patch to the be2net implementation in the kernel package before 2.6.32-218.el6 on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) 6, when promiscuous mode is enabled,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(system crash) via non-member VLAN packets.

CVE: CVE-2011-3638
CVE: CVE-2011-3638
Id:
CVE-2011-3638
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2011-3638
Comment
: fs/ext4/extents.c in the Linux kernel before 3.0 does not mark a modified extent as dirty in certain cases of extent splitting, which allows local users to cause a denial of service (system crash) via vectors involving ext4 umount and mount operations.

CVE: CVE-2011-4110
CVE: CVE-2011-4110
Id:
CVE-2011-4110
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2011-4110
Comment
: The user_update function in security/keys/user_defined.c in the Linux kernel 2.6 allows local users to cause a denial of service (NULL pointer dereference and kernel oops) via vectors related to a user-defined key and "updating a negative key into a fully instantiated key."
